Output d96988dc9158e10817c1e36faa4af835cfdfbd02058302c59639087b9d9b229d:1

value
38066313
script pubkey
OP_0 OP_PUSHBYTES_20 36a24827c05ed00982ec1d1f96a655153a599ec8
address
bc1qx63ysf7qtmgqnqhvr50edfj4z5a9n8kgtgwws8
transaction
d96988dc9158e10817c1e36faa4af835cfdfbd02058302c59639087b9d9b229d
confirmations
145286
spent
true